to alloy
01
합금을 만들다, 섞다
to combine two or more metals to make a more suitable one
Transitive: to alloy two or more metals
Ditransitive: to alloy a metal with another
예시들
The jeweler alloyed gold with other metals to create a stronger and more affordable alloy for jewelry.
보석상은 더 강하고 저렴한 보석용 합금을 만들기 위해 금을 다른 금속과 합금했습니다.
